The second annual Flooring Sustainability Summit expects 250 industry leaders in Washington D.C., says Bill Griese, deputy executive director Tile Council of North America. This year's focus: navigating federal policy uncertainty, standardizing "circularity" terminology, and launching design awards. The summit builds ongoing community dialogue beyond the two-day event, driving real marketplace alignment on sustainability efforts.

Footprints Floors' new headquarters features a 3,000-square-foot training warehouse that can accommodate up to 20 franchisees simultaneously. This consolidates the entire training process under one roof while supporting the company's goal of reaching 200 franchise locations over the next decade.
